在Windows环境下搭建前端开发环境,运行库的管理是关键一步。现代前端项目依赖大量第三方库,如Node.js、npm/yarn、Vue、React等,合理配置这些运行库能显著提升开发效率与稳定性。
推荐使用Node.js版本管理工具,如nvm-windows。它允许在不同项目中切换Node.js版本,避免因版本冲突导致的构建失败。安装后,通过命令行即可快速切换版本,确保项目兼容性。
包管理工具的选择同样重要。npm是默认选项,但yarn和pnpm在依赖安装速度和磁盘占用方面表现更优。pnpm通过硬链接共享依赖,极大减少重复文件,适合大型项目。根据团队习惯选择,并统一项目配置,避免混乱。

AI图片,仅供参考
为优化性能,建议将全局包安装路径迁移到非系统盘。例如,将npm包目录设置在D:\
pm\\global,避免C盘空间被频繁占用。可通过npm config set prefix \”D:\
pm\\global\”实现自定义路径。
清理无用依赖是长期维护的重要环节。定期运行npm outdated或yarn outdated检查过期包,及时更新。同时,删除未使用的devDependencies,可减小项目体积并降低安全风险。
使用缓存机制能显著加快重复安装速度。npm和yarn都支持本地缓存,启用后可跳过重复下载。若网络受限,可配置镜像源,如淘宝镜像(https://registry.npmmirror.com),提升下载效率。
•建立项目初始化脚本,包含依赖安装、环境检测和启动命令。通过package.json中的scripts字段统一管理,使新成员快速上手,减少配置错误。